Job Description
Senior Electrical Engineer
Salary Up to $150,000 + Bonus + Excellent Benefits + Paid Relocation to a Southern Metro
The Senior Electrical Engineer leads capital and expense projects, supports daily operations, and strengthens the plant’s electrical and controls capabilities. This role partners closely with Operations, Maintenance, and E&I Technicians to troubleshoot issues, improve reliability, and drive technical upgrades. The position reports to the Engineering Manager.
Key Responsibilities for this Senior Electrical Engineer:
- Manage and execute electrical and controls projects from concept through commissioning.
- Build expertise in tissue manufacturing equipment, utilities, and instrumentation.
- Customize and support MES, ERP, and HMI systems to improve data flow and machine control.
- Ensure compliance with electrical safety standards, NEC, NFPA 70, and Arc Flash requirements.
- Troubleshoot PLCs, HMIs, VFDs, servo drives, sensors, and power distribution systems.
- Maintain documentation for electrical drawings, PLC programs, and control software.
- Mentor junior engineers and deliver training for operations and maintenance teams.
- Identify process bottlenecks and implement control system improvements.
- Conduct failure analysis and drive reliability enhancements.
- Manage project budgets and communicate progress to stakeholders.
- Follow all environmental policies and report hazards or incidents.
Minimum Qualifications for this Senior Electrical Engineer position:
- Bachelor degree in Electrical Engineering.
- Minimum 3 years in industrial manufacturing or technical engineering roles.
- Strong troubleshooting skills with PLCs, VFDs, HMIs, DCS, and power distribution.
- Ability to work independently and collaborate across functions.
- Strong vendor management and hands‑on technical capability.
- Working knowledge of NEC and NFPA 70.
- Strong communication, analytical, and organizational skills.
- Ability to train others, manage multiple priorities, and perform in a fast‑paced environment.
- Demonstrated integrity, teamwork, accountability, problem‑solving, and customer focus.
